CaseScan is an advanced platform utilizing AI for content detection targeted at online platforms, Trust & Safety teams, and law enforcement agencies. This innovative tool merges deep-learning techniques for image and video analysis with both exact and perceptual hashing methods to identify known CSAM, as well as previously unidentified CSAM, AI-generated content, and altered sexual imagery.
For online service providers, CaseScan offers a comprehensive API and SDK that seamlessly integrates into various aspects of their operations, including uploads, storage solutions, streaming services, avatar management, and chat functionalities. The results generated from detection processes can facilitate automated blocking, enable human review, trigger escalations, assist in takedown procedures, and enhance reporting mechanisms. Additionally, CaseScan is designed with a cloud-native, auto-scaling architecture that adheres to a strict zero media retention policy during the scanning of content.
In the context of law enforcement, CaseScan acts as both a field and laboratory triage tool, aiding investigators in the identification and prioritization of suspected CSAM found on confiscated devices, including content that has not been previously cataloged. This system can function independently without the need for internet connectivity or access to external databases, and it incorporates protective features for investigators, such as automatic image blurring to maintain anonymity and safety. By providing these capabilities, CaseScan enhances both preventative measures and investigative efficiency in the fight against online exploitation.

An integrated online platform for brand protection and digital risk management. It features user-friendly dashboards, comprehensive reporting, and straightforward takedown processes. The platform employs an automated, neural-based detection system that serves both businesses and analysts. With a dedicated team of over 70 cybersecurity and brand protection experts worldwide, users benefit from specialized knowledge and support. The platform's unique neural network leverages leading proprietary detection methodologies, achieving up to 90% accuracy in identifying violations, akin to a seasoned professional. Incorporating threat intelligence, it identifies cybercriminal infrastructure while exploring additional strategies for effective violation elimination. Utilizing an actor-centric investigation approach, it analyzes and predicts scammer behavior, enhancing detection and takedown efforts. Furthermore, the algorithmic correlation of related resources and entities aids in attributing and dismantling scam operations, thereby significantly reducing the risk of future attacks. This comprehensive system ensures businesses can navigate the complex landscape of digital threats with confidence.
